Can anyone help. I had to uninstall and re-install my McAfee Security Centre
and since then, my Outlook keeps asking for my user name and password. It
didn't do this before. I have tried entering my e-mail user name and
password but to no avail. The error says "Invalid uer name and password
(Account Blueyonder, POP3 Server:127.0.0.1, Error Number: 0x800ccc92)

Please can somebody help as its driving me mad using the webmail service!

First, discontinue virus checking for incoming and outgoing email in McAfee.
Then, enter the proper server info in your account info in Outlook, as
McAfee has changed it to "127.0.0.1". You should be fine after that.

Virus checking outgoing and incoming email is redundant, as the anti-virus
program will still catch any viruses that it comes in contact with.
